Sustainable Finance: A Growing Force in Global Markets
Sustainable finance is becoming a prominent force in global markets. Investors are increasingly prioritizing investments that align with environmental, social, and governance (ESG) standards. This trend is driven by a increasing awareness of the impact of financial decisions on sustainability and the urgency to address global challenges such as climate change.
As a result, there has been exponential growth in sustainable finance initiatives. Investors are turning to sustainable funds to support socially responsible projects. Governments and regulatory bodies are also adopting policies to promote sustainable finance practices. The future of finance is undeniably connected with sustainability, and this trend is accelerating momentum worldwide.
